I am currently in hospital, with my 2nd ectopic. I was informed yesterday after my scan and bloods that a small sack could be seen in my womb but also that my left ovary was enlarged ( where my burning and throbbing sensation is).
At 9pm last night I was admitted to the ward and told I would get bloods repeated after 48hrs. Less than two years ago I nearly lost my life due to a rupture that was caught too late despite several trips to a and e! I was left to the point I lost my tube.
Dr’s are saying they will keep a close eye on me but as my blood pressure is fine and I’m not detororting (yet) they will wait for my bloods again tomorrow.
I am in discomfort and was told by the registra that my bcg levels are high and they would have seen more than the sack in my womb and they do believe that the ovary is where the pregnancy is sitting!
So why can’t they do something now?
I don’t know wether I should be demanding to be taken to theatre!
I can feel the bulge I can feel the burning and my chest and back ache.
Advise would be really appreciated as I know survey is not something to take lightly but it’s my life and I’m struggling with my gut instincts and what I’m being told!
Would love to know if anyone has any similar experience and what they did x
